# Java根据数组索引Java中,我们经常需要根据数组来获取对应索引位置。这在实际开发中是一个非常常见需求,比如在查找某个元素在数组位置、根据某个条件筛选元素等操作中会用到。本文将介绍如何在Java根据数组取得索引,并提供一些示例代码进行演示。 ## 实现方法 在Java中,我们可以通过遍历数组方式来查找特定数组位置。具体实现方法包括使用for循环
原创 7月前
190阅读
# 如何实现“javaScript 根据索引截取数组” ## 介绍 作为一名经验丰富开发者,我将会指导你如何在 JavaScript 中根据索引来截取数组。这是一个常见需求,可以帮助你更好地处理数组操作。在本文中,我将为你详细介绍整个流程,并提供每一步所需代码以及解释。 ## 整体流程 首先让我们来看看整件事情流程,我们可以用一个表格来展示这些步骤。 ```markdown |
原创 4月前
72阅读
SONPath是查询JSON对象元素标准方法。JSONPath使用路径表达式来导航JSON文档中元素,嵌套元素和数组。有关JSON更多信息,请参阅JSON简介。使用JSONPath访问JSON元素接下来,您可以找到如何使用JSONPath表达式访问JSON格式数据中各种元素。对于本节中示例,假设源流包含以下格式JSON记录。 { "customerName":"John Do
在日常工作中我们不可避免地会遇到慢SQL问题,比如笔者在之前公司时会定期收到DBA彪哥发来Oracle AWR报告,并特别提示我某条sql近阶段执行明显很慢,可能要优化一下等。对于这样问题通常大家第一反应就是看看sql是不是写不合理啊诸如:“避免使用in和not in,否则可能会导致全表扫描”“ 避免在where子句中对字段进行函数操作”等等,还有一种常见反应就是这个表有没有加索引?绝
php根据key删除数组元素方法:首先根据key使用array_keys()函数和array_search()函数查找要删除元素开始位置x;然后使用“array_splice(数组, x, 1);”来删除指定数组元素即可。本教程操作环境:windows7系统、PHP7.1版,DELL G3电脑php数组中元素存在方式是以键值对方式('key'=>'value'),有时候我们需要根据
Linux shell数组详解前提变量数组数组声明声明索引数组声明关联数组数组赋值数组引用数组中常用变量数组其它操作示例 前提程序是指 指令 + 数据 组合。指令:bash脚本中代码(函数、调用命令等)数据:变量、数组、文件等变量变量 是 存储单个元素内存空间。数组数组 是 存储多个元素连续内存空间。数组格式: # 数组名[数组索引] # 数组名:整个数组只有一个名字
数组索引:  1、ndarray对象内容可以通过索引或切片来访问和修改,与 Python 中 list 切片操作一样;     由于数组可能是多维,所以必须为数组每个维度指定一个切片,使用切片时返回是一个子数组  2、整数索引:获取相应下标的元素  3、布尔数组索引:布尔索引通过布尔运算来获取符合指定条件元素数组  4、花式索引:不同索引之间可以相互搭配,同时也可以和
# Python列表根据索引方法 ## 导言 在Python编程中,列表是一种非常常用数据结构,它可以存储多个元素并且允许重复。当我们需要查找列表中某个特定元素索引时,可以通过一些简单方法实现。本文将介绍如何使用Python语言实现“列表根据索引功能。 ## 目录 - 准备工作 - 方法一:使用index()方法 - 方法二:使用enumerate()函数 - 方法三:使用列
原创 11月前
596阅读
ndarray一维数组元素选取与Python列表切片操作很相似,与列表不同时,获取数据组成一个新数组但与原有的数组共享一个内存存储空间,即数据更改获取得到数据中某个元素,原有数组也会产生相应变化。 下面列举其种常见选取方式 首页使用arange快速创建一个一维数组#coding=utf-8 import numpy as np arr1 = np.arange(10)[0 1
数组也是引用类型构造函数创建数组Object 构造函数类型(所有类型基类)   Array 构造函数类型求幂运算符 **    2**32-1 数组容量最大arry.length 如果减小length 则相当于截断数组 不要这样用!数组字面量创建数组  数组索引都是从0开始var arr = [1,2,'ss',true,{age:19},null,undefined]
专注于Java领域优质技术,欢迎关注作者:寻找海蓝96数组几乎可以是所有软件工程师最常用到数据结构,正是因为如此,很多开发者对其不够重视.而面试中经常有这样一类问题: 「100万个成员数组第一个和最后一个有性能差距吗?为什么?」除此之外,我们在平时业务开发中会经常出现数组一把梭情况,大多数情况下我们都会用数组形式进行操作,而有读源码习惯开发者可能会发现,在一些底层库中,我们可能平时用
## Python 数组根据查找索引实现步骤 在Python中,要实现根据查找数组索引功能,可以使用以下步骤来完成: 1. 创建一个数组(列表); 2. 判断数组中是否存在要查找; 3. 如果存在,返回该数组索引; 4. 如果不存在,返回一个特定或错误信息。 下面我们将逐步详细介绍如何实现这一功能,并提供相应代码。 ### 1. 创建一个数组(列表) 首先,我们需
原创 11月前
280阅读
# Python数组根据查找索引 在使用Python进行数据处理和分析时,经常需要根据数组查找对应索引。Python提供了多种方式来实现这一功能,本文将介绍其中一些常用方法,并给出相应代码示例。 ## 方法一:使用`index()`函数 Python`list`类型提供了一个`index()`函数,可以返回数组中某个第一个匹配项索引。下面是一个简单示例: ```py
原创 9月前
142阅读
# 如何在Python中数组某个索引 ## 简介 在Python中,我们可以通过索引来访问数组元素。当我们需要查找数组中特定索引时,可以使用内置index()方法。本文将教你如何在Python中数组某个索引。 ## 流程图 ```mermaid flowchart LR A[开始] --> B(创建数组) B --> C(查找索引) C --
原创 5月前
21阅读
1、数组简介在内存中,数组存储在连续取悦内部,因为数组中每个元素类型形同,则占用内存大小也一致,所以在访问数组元素时,可以直接根据数组在内存中起始位置以及下标来计算元素位置。因此数组访问速度很高。在C#中,数组下标(也称索引)是从0开始。以后逐个递增,最大索引数组元素总数减1数组元素可以为任何数据类型,每个数组都有长度,为了方便管理在初始化数组时,必须指定数组长度,而且一旦指
问题管道查询输出结果是数组,只想获取数组中某个特定索引,和java一样解决$arrayElemAt聚合查询"studyTime2": {$arrayElemAt:["$str.name",0]}
原创 2023-01-14 09:50:24
208阅读
# Java数组实现步骤 作为一名经验丰富开发者,我将为你详细介绍在Java中如何取得数组。以下是整个流程步骤表格: | 步骤 | 描述 | | --- | --- | | 1 | 声明数组 | | 2 | 分配内存空间 | | 3 | 初始化数组元素 | | 4 | 取得数组 | 接下来,我将逐步解释每个步骤需要做什么,并提供相应代码示例和注释,以帮助你理解。 ## 步
原创 2023-08-15 07:54:09
310阅读
关于索引理解以前以为索引,就是在表中一个主键列,比如id,但其实如果id在没有加特殊意义情况下,id列就仅仅是一个列,如select student where id = 1001;其实和select student where  name = "小明";效率并没有差多少,本质上都需要遍历,而且是全表遍历完,找到where后面对应条件行进行返回。而加了主键的话,也只是加了一种
pandas采用了很多Numpy代码风格,但是最大不同在于pandas用来处理表格型或者异质类数据。而Numpy则相反,它更适合处理同质型数值类数组数据。SeriesSeries是一种一维数组型对象,它包含了一个序列,并且包含了数据标签,也就是索引。import pandas as pd from pandas import Series, DataFrame obj = pd.Seri
今天在 交流群里看到有同学讨论使数组随机化问题,其中给出算法很不错,让我想起了之前自己实现过不怎么“漂亮”方法。想想我们有时候在繁忙写业务代码时只是为了实现其功能,并未花太大心思去思考是否有更好实现方法。就这个数组问题(随即排序一个数组,返回一个新数组)来说,我以前实现方法是这样:function randArr(arr) { var ret = [], ob
  • 1
  • 2
  • 3
  • 4
  • 5